4. How to install the fonts


Stage 1: downloading and unpackaging

First of all, download the required font packages from the following links to your computer:

Next, you need to extract files from the ZIP file(s) to the folder that you can find later.  If you cannot do this on your system, you may want to use a 3rd-party software such as Winzip for this task.

Each ZIP file contains TrueType font(s) and the accompanying documentations in both PDF and Word file. Note that to read a PDF file, you need Adobe Acrobat Reader.

Stage 2: installing fonts on your System [Windows XP / Vista and 7/ Mac, etc.]

(1) Windows XP (and earlier systems)

If you are not familiar with the font installation, please read Microsoft's instructions "how to install or remove a font in Windows" first.

  1. Click "Start" button and choose "Control Panel".
  2. Inside "Control Panel" window, find "Fonts" and open it. You will see a list of all the installed fonts in your computer.
  3. If you have an older version of the font already installed, remove it from your font folder. (You should take a backup copy just in case you need it later.)
  4. From the "File" menu, choose "Install New Font...", and find the font file(s) you have just extracted in a folder of your choice.
  5. Select all the font files in the folder, and click OK. Windows should install the fonts.
  6. Your operating system now has the font, ready to use.

(2) Windows Vista, Windows 7

If you are not familiar with the font installation, please read Microsoft's instructions "how to install or remove a font in Windows" first.
  1. Click "Start" button and choose "Control Panel", and "Appearance and Personalization", and then "Fonts". There you will see a list of all the installed fonts in your computer.
  2. If you have an older version of the font already installed, remove it from your font folder. (You should take a backup copy just in case you need it later.)
  3. From the "File" menu in VISTA, choose "Install New Font...", and find the font file(s) you have just extracted in a folder of your choice. (If you don't see the File menu, press ALT.); Windows 7 doesn't show a File menu. Just drag the Bach font files (bach41.TTF, etc.) into this folder.
  4. Select all the font files in the folder where you have extracted the package, and click OK. Windows should install the fonts.
  5. Your operating system now has the font, ready to use.

Stage 3: testing your system

In each font package, you will find a documentation in Word file, which makes use of the font to demonstrate the font. If you have successfully installed the font, the Word file should show the musical symbols in the document correctly. (Compare its contents with the PDF file provided).
